The Job of Medical Assistants

medical assistant with Richmond MI nursing home patientThe role of a medical assistant can be varied as well as demanding. Primarily their role is to make sure that the Richmond MI clinics, hospitals and other medical care institutions where they work run efficiently. Depending on the size or type of facility, they may be more of a clinical assistant, an administrative assistant, or in smaller facilities both. They are tasked with giving direct assistance to the nurses, doctors and other health professionals but may also be found working in an office or at the front desk. Some of the many duties of a medical assistant include:

  • Filling out insurance forms and submitting claims
  • Setting and verifying appointments
  • Weighing and taking patients vital signs
  • Collecting blood and other fluid and tissue samples
  • Preparing instruments and rooms for doctors
  • Providing basic support during exams and procedures

Although medical assistants can perform almost any duty they are qualified to under Michigan law, some opt to specialize in a specific area and attain certification. Two of the options available are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) offered by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Training Programs

Compared to most other medical professionals, medical assistants are not mandated to become certified, licensed, or to have a college degree. However, a number of Richmond MI health care employers prefer to h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training program (more on accreditation later ) that are certified. There are essentially two choices offered for a formal education. The first and shortest path to becoming a medical assistant is to acquire a diploma or a certificate. These programs usually take about one year to finish, a few as little as 6 to 9 months. They are developed to teach the fundamentals of medical assisting and prepare graduates for entry level positions. The second alternative is to earn an Associate Degree, which are typically 2 year programs provided at community and junior colleges in addition to vocational and technical schools. They are more expansive in design than the diploma or certificate programs, and include general education courses in addition to the medical assistant training. They often have a clinical component involving an internship with a local medical practice. Associate Degrees are routinely a pre-requisite for and credits can be applied to a 4 year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a related field.

Certification Options for Medical Assistants

As earlier stated, certification is not a legal requirement, but is an excellent choice for those who want to boost their careers. It will not only help in attaining employment after graduation, but it may also enhance initial salary negotiations. Some potential Richmond MI medical employers just will not employ a medical assistant that has not obtained certification or accredited formal training. The most popular and possibly the most respected cert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) provided by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). To qualify to sit for the CMA examination, a candidate must have graduated or will graduate within 30 days from an accredited medical assistant program. Alternative certifications are offered also, including the CMAA and the CCMA that we previously mentioned which are offered by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ant Program Accredited? There are a number of great reasons to verify that the college you enroll in is accredited. To begin with, accreditation helps guarantee that the instruction you receive will be both extensive and of the highest quality. Second, if you plan on becoming certified, you need to enroll in an accredited program. Two of the accepted organizations for accreditation are the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P) and the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ES). If your school is not accredited by one of these organizations, you will not be allowed to take the CMA exam. Also, if you intend on applying for a student loan or financial assistance, they are frequently not available for non-accredited programs. And finally, as previously mentioned, a number of prospective Richmond MI employers will not hire a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ited school.

Richmond, Michigan

Richmond is a city on the border between Macomb and St. Clair counties within Metro Detroit and the U.S. state of Michigan. The population was 5,735 at the 2010 census. Most of the city is located in Macomb County, though there is a small portion in St. Clair County. The city is adjacent to Richmond Township and Lenox Township in Macomb County, although it is administratively autonomous. It is also adjacent to St. Clair County's Columbus Township and Casco Township.

As of the census[9] of 2010, there were 5,735 people residing in the city. The population density was 2,012.3 inhabitants per square mile (777.0/km2). There were 2,479 housing units at an average density of 869.8 per square mile (335.8/km2). The racial makeup of the city was 94.2% White, 1.0% African American, 0.3% Native American, 0.2% Asian, 0.2% Pacific Islander, 2.6% from other races, and 1.5%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 4.6% of the population.

As of the census[2] of 2000, there were 4,897 people, 1,977 households, and 1,332 families residing in the city. The population density was 1,691.6 per square mile (654.2/km²). There were 2,062 housing units at an average density of 712.3 per square mile (275.5/km²). The racial makeup of the city was 95.43% White, 0.25% African American, 0.31% Native American, 0.82% Asian, 0.18% Pacific Islander, 1.86% from other races, and 1.16%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 4.74% of the population.
